Do all cat's puke? Mine didn't puke once, ive had her for about 4-5 months
it's not puke technically but regurgitating hairballs. it happens with the cats that have lots of shed hair, clean themselves regularly and don't have ways to remove it from their bodies (for some malt paste, certain foods and treats help, for others not so much). it looks like a little turd (it's shaped like a cat's throat so yeah) covered in food, so it's easy to assume they did their business outside litterbox, while it's actually their fur just getting stuck and bothering them. some cats will be just naturally more likely to have them.
